Cuprins:

Proiectul semaforului Arduino [cu trecere de pietoni]: 3 pași
Proiectul semaforului Arduino [cu trecere de pietoni]: 3 pași

Video: Proiectul semaforului Arduino [cu trecere de pietoni]: 3 pași

Video: Proiectul semaforului Arduino [cu trecere de pietoni]: 3 pași
Video: Semnalizarea feroviară de tip BLA la scara H0 - v1.0 2024, Iulie
Anonim
Proiect semafor Arduino [cu trecere de pietoni]
Proiect semafor Arduino [cu trecere de pietoni]

Dacă căutați ceva ușor, simplu și, în același timp, doriți să impresionați pe toată lumea cu Arduino, atunci proiectul semaforului este probabil cea mai bună alegere, mai ales atunci când sunteți începător în lumea Arduino.

Mai întâi vom vedea cum să facem un mecanism simplu de semafor, apoi să-l facem mai interesant, adăugăm și asigurarea trecerii pentru pietoni. Această postare va acoperi elementele necesare, procedura pas cu pas și codul final care trebuie încărcat pe Ardunio pentru ca totul să funcționeze.

Asadar, hai sa incepem!

Pasul 1: Elemente necesare

Elemente necesare
Elemente necesare
Elemente necesare
Elemente necesare
Elemente necesare
Elemente necesare
Elemente necesare
Elemente necesare

Dacă vă recomandăm să utilizați următoarele elemente listate numai pentru ca acest proiect să funcționeze cu succes.

Arduino:

1 rezistor de 10k-ohm:

1 x comutator cu buton:

6 rezistoare de 220 ohmi:

O pană de verificare:

Conectarea firelor:

LED-uri roșii, galbene și verzi:

Pasul 2: Cum funcționează sistemul de semafoare?

În acest proiect vom simula sistemul de semafoare ca în viața reală. LED-ul roșu va fi aprins timp de 15 secunde, urmat de galben și verde. Apoi, verde se va opri și galbenul va fi pornit timp de câteva secunde, urmat de roșu din nou și ciclul va porni.

Acum, dacă includem caracteristica de trecere a pietonilor, luminile de semnalizare ar trebui să funcționeze pe LED-ul ROȘU ori de câte ori cineva apasă butonul de trecere ca în viața reală. Deci, în loc să se schimbe luminile la fiecare 15 secunde, lumina se va schimba numai atunci când butonul este activat.

Acum, să învățăm cum să punem totul împreună

Pasul 3: Pași de urmat

Pașii de urmat
Pașii de urmat
Pași de urmat
Pași de urmat

1. În primul rând, să facem circuitul pentru un sistem de semafor normal fără funcția de trecere a pietonilor. Asigurați-vă că urmați schema de circuit exactă, deoarece programul este proiectat în consecință.

2. Acum că ați obținut prima jumătate la locul său, să adăugăm caracteristica de trecere a pietonilor cu puțină adăugare la schema de circuit existentă.

3. Încărcați codul Arduino creat pentru acest proiect. Puteți găsi codul în acest link:

4. Bingo! sunteți pregătiți să vă testați sistemul de semafor cu trecerea de pietoni.

Recomandat: